Transaction bffa89c3182fd7ee80e8c83a34e492914043378fb48eac124013766146131e31
1 Input
1 Outputs
- bffa89c3182fd7ee80e8c83a34e492914043378fb48eac124013766146131e31:0
value 74205926
address 1C7cZ6xJqimbRGoH61K7Y5ue5a7phy5S6q